From Bloomberg:
http://www.bloomberg.com/slidesh ... ces-by-country.html
Hong Kong
Price per gallon of premium gasoline: $8.61
Price change since last quarter: -3.1
Most-expensive-gas rank: #4
Pain-at-the-pump rank: #35

Hong Kong is a part of China but has its own constitution, its own political structure and its own price of gas. Hong Kong residents pay 76 percent more for a gallon of gas than their neighbors in China, where the government caps the price at the pump.

vs Singapore:
Price per gallon of premium gasoline: $6.08
Price change since last quarter: -9.3%
Most-expensive-gas rank: #35
Pain-at-the-pump rank: #50

The densely urban archipelago of Singapore, made up of 63 separate islands, has one of the smallest networks of roads, spanning just 2,085 miles. Still, Singapore consumes more than the average share of gasoline and is among the world's 10 biggest oil importers.

The people of Singapore experience relatively little pain at the pump. The average daily income is one of the world's highest, at $138. The share of a day's wages needed to buy a gallon of gas is 4.4 percent.

vs China


China
Price per gallon of premium gasoline: $4.89
Price change since last quarter: -7.9%
Most-expensive-gas rank: #45
Pain-at-the-pump rank: #8

China is the world's second-biggest oil consumer, after the U.S. With its burgeoning middle class, China's consumption is only expected to increase. The number of vehicles in the country may rise to 260 million by 2020, matching current U.S. levels, from 80 million last year, according to the State Information Center.

China regulates the prices of retail gasoline and diesel fuel as a tool to curb inflation. On August 10, the country said it will increase gas prices about 4.3 percent, the first hike since March, to keep up with the rising cost of imported crude.

China ranks in the top 10 for pain at the pump, despite a gas price that beats the global average by more than 20 percent. With an average daily income of $16, the share of a day's wages needed to buy a gallon of gas in China is 30 percent.

vs.....

Venezuela
Price per gallon of premium gasoline: $0.09
Price change since last quarter: 0%
Most-expensive-gas rank: #60
Pain-at-the-pump rank: #60

Dreaming of cheaper gas? Fill up in Venezuela, where gas at 9 cents a gallon is the cheapest and most subsidized in the world. Even with a relatively low daily income of $30, the share of a day's wages needed to buy a gallon of gas is the lowest anywhere, at 0.3 percent.

President Hugo Chavez has called in the past for the country to reduce its rising gas consumption, but with fuel this cheap there's little incentive to do so. Decades of inexpensive gas have persuaded many Venezuelans to consider it part of the social contract. The last time the country tried to cut subsidies, in 1989, it was torn by riots that killed hundreds of people.

The cost of filling up the 39-gallon tank of a Chevrolet Suburban in Venezuela is $3.51, compared with $146.25 in the U.S and $394.68 in Norway.

The power of social media has revealed itself today in the form of fluctuation in fuel prices based on a false tweet.
According to The Wall Street Journal, a Twitter account claiming to be Russian Interior Minister Vladamir Kolokoltsv tweeted that Syrian president Bashar al-Assad had been injured or killed. That tweet which occurred at 9:59 AM EST, was followed by two more tweets alleging the confirmation of al-Assad's death.

In the hour following that tweet, light, sweet crude prices rose from $90.82 to $91.99, and the jump took place in between 10:15 and 10:45. According to the Reuters report, the Russian ministry denies firing off the tweets and denies any connection to the account.

Price Futures Group analyst Phil Flynn pointed out "a well-placed story can move the market, and that looks like what happened." Though Syria itself is not a major oil producer, it is feared that Iran would react to the news because of their connection to and support of Assad

In the wake of sanctions imposed due to their continued participation in a nuclear weapons program, Iran has threatened to close off the Straight of Hormuz, a major throughway for ships carrying crude oil to the rest of the world.

Because of the hypersensitivity of the international tensions in the Middle East, and those trading in oils who follow the area closely, the rumor of Assad's demised spread like wildfire. The combination of Mideast unrest, and the spread of information through texts and tweets means it's unlikely this is the last time something like this will happen.
